コード例 #1
0
        public void Parse_WellFormedErrorsJson_ProducesValidErrorList()
        {
            var errorsJson = GetResourceAsString(Constants.ErrorsSimpleResource);

            var ejp = new ErrorJsonParser();

            Assert.Equal(errors, ejp.FromString(errorsJson).Errors,
                         new ErrorComparer());
        }
コード例 #2
0
        public void Serialize_ErrorsList_ProducesWellFormedJson()
        {
            var erh  = new ErrorResourceHandler();
            var ejp  = new ErrorJsonParser();
            var json = ejp.ToString(errors);

            erh.WriteFile(json);
            Assert.Equal(GetResourceAsString(Constants.ErrorsSimpleResource), erh.ResultJson);
        }